你什么时候要连数据库,就在那个相应的 事件的函数里进行连接string strConnection ="data source=ITDB02;initial catalog=NewSurvey ;user id=sa;password=1234";
SqlConnection conn = new SqlConnection(strConnection);
conn.Open();

解决方案 »

  1.   

    找一本ado.net编程的书看看,或者去MSDN上面查询一下
      

  2.   

    在Global.asax里加上这个吧!
    <Script Language="c#" Runat="Server">

    protected void Application_Start(Object sender, EventArgs e)
    {
               Application["MySource"] = "server=127.0.0.0;uid=用户;pwd=密码;database=数据库名";
    }

    </Script>
    在用到的地方直接用MySoure就可以了!
      

  3.   

    有个错字,Server应该是:127.0.0.1
      

  4.   

    在web.config中添加
      <appSettings>
    <add key="sqlConn" value="server=服务器名;database=用户名;uid=sa;pwd="></add> 
     
      </appSettings>
    调用时候用
    system.ConfigurationSettings.AppSettings("sqlConn").ToString读取出来
      

  5.   

    补充一下,上面偶发的贴子调用的时候这样:
    Sqlstr_D2="select * from 表名";
    SqlConnection Myconnection_D2 = new SqlConnection(Application["MySource"].ToString());
    SqlDataAdapter Mycommnad_D2 =new  SqlDataAdapter(Sqlstr_D2,Myconnection_D2);
    DataSet ds =new DataSet();